Patcharee Rompayom Wichaidit
Institution: Faculty of Education, Chulalongkorn University
Country: Thailand
Patcharee earned her Bachelor of Science in Chemistry with Second-Class Honours in 2004. She then completed a one-year Graduate Diploma in Teaching Profession in 2005. Later, she pursued her graduate studies in a combined master’s-to-doctoral track and completed her Doctor of Philosophy in Science Education in 2010. During 2008-2009 in this Ed.D. program, she spend time in doing research and got a certificate of the one year program of “The Program to Promote Research Methods in Science Education” at the University of Wisconsin-Madison, Wisconsin, USA.
Over 16 years of professional experience, she has taught at the university level in both undergraduate and graduate programs, particularly in the areas of Chemistry Education, Science Education, and STEM Education. During her professional career, she was awarded funding for professional development at Massey University, Manawatu campus, in Palmerston North, New Zealand, where she undertook a three-month academic development program. She also received university funding to collaborate for one month with researchers at the National Institute of Education (NIE), Singapore. She has published academic work in international journals indexed in Scopus and the ERIC database, with research focusing on chemical education, science education, and STEM education.
